Sensing With Computing

by Sense Lab


πŸ“˜ About

This repository collects and organizes key references in the emerging field of Sensing with Computing, a paradigm that tightly fuses sensing and computation to overcome traditional interface bottlenecks. The goal is to provide researchers, students, and practitioners with an overview of important works spanning near-sensor, in-sensor, and pre-sensor computing architectures, as well as highly-relevant algorithmic and co-design methodologies.

All references are listed in chronological order to reflect the historical development of the field, and not by importance. This collection is continuously updated and aims to serve as a useful resource for exploring the evolution and future directions of sensing with computing integration.
